    Security Considerations

    When remotely accessing your Raspberry Pi, security should be a top priority. Here are some best practices to keep your device secure:

    • Use strong, unique passwords for your Raspberry Pi and RemoteIoT account.
    • Enable two-factor authentication (2FA) whenever possible.
    • Regularly update your Raspberry Pi OS and RemoteIoT software.
    • Limit access to trusted IP addresses if feasible.

    Firewall Configuration

    Configuring a firewall can add an extra layer of protection. Use tools like UFW (Uncomplicated Firewall) to restrict incoming connections and only allow traffic on necessary ports.

    Troubleshooting Common Issues

    Even with proper setup, you might encounter issues while using RemoteIoT. Here are some common problems and their solutions:

    • Connection Issues: Ensure both your Raspberry Pi and the remote device are connected to the internet. Check your network settings and firewall configurations.
    • Login Failures: Verify your credentials and ensure there are no typos. If the problem persists, reset your password.
    • Slow Performance: Optimize your network bandwidth and consider upgrading your internet connection if necessary.

    Performance Optimization

    To ensure optimal performance when using RemoteIoT, consider the following tips:

    • Upgrade Hardware: Invest in a Raspberry Pi with more processing power and memory.
    • Optimize Network Settings: Use wired connections whenever possible to reduce latency.
    • Regular Maintenance: Keep your Raspberry Pi and RemoteIoT software updated to benefit from the latest improvements and bug fixes.
